AN ACTIVE MINI-PROINSULIN, M2PI
Disease
Known diseases associated with this structure: Diabetes mellitus, rare form OMIM:[176730], Hyperproinsulinemia, familial OMIM:[176730], MODY, one form OMIM:[176730]
About this Structure
1EFE is a Single protein structure of sequence from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
